W. P. Nos. 29145, 30408 and 35168 of 2007 are preferred under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ying for the issue of a writ of certiorarified mandamus to call for the records of the first respondent's order in proceedings bearing Ref. No. CA/1/2007/NMN(MHRD), dated 6. 8. 2007 and to quash the same and consequently to direct the first respondent not to interfere with the membership of the petitioner's representatives as Council Members and also not to interfere with the tenure of the membership of the petitioners as its council members.
